The University of Nevada, Reno is seeking a collaborative and strategic leader to fill the role of Associate Vice President for Compliance and Research Administration.  In this position, you will be responsible for overseeing the development, implementation, and monitoring of policies and procedures related to award administration activities, environmental health and safety, animal care and use programs, and human subject-related research. Working closely with upper-level administration, you will ensure that all research activities comply with federal, state, and university regulations, and that our researchers have the resources and support they need to carry out their work with integrity and safety.

 

As the liaison between principal investigators, research sponsors, and various university offices and committees, you will ensure that all sponsored agreements and awards are processed in a timely and effective manner, and negotiate non-standard terms and conditions of awards, grants, and contracts with government contract officers and private company attorneys. You will also oversee compliance and regulatory affairs, manage the accreditation process of various bodies, and coordinate audits and monitoring activities to ensure compliance with sponsor and federal regulations.

 

In addition to your administrative duties, you will lead a team of directors responsible for sponsored projects, research integrity, environmental health and safety, and animal resources; ensuring that staff are properly trained and coached to handle complex compliance issues, operational and process improvement opportunities, and change management within their departments. You will also provide support to the Vice President for Research and Innovation in budget development and strategic planning, conceptualizing data reporting to enhance decision-making, and completing other tasks and projects as assigned.

Grants-in-aid for Faculty Employees

The University is proud to provide a reduced-rate tuition benefit to faculty and qualified dependents. Faculty can take up to six credits per semester at a reduced rate. Dependents of faculty have unlimited credits, but in order to be eligible children must be unmarried and under the age of 24 and must receive at least 50% of their financial support from the employee and/or employee’s spouse or domestic partner.  Faculty Grants-in-Aid
